[Letter from Truett Latimer to Rupert N. Richardson, April 17, 1957]

Letter from Truett Latimer to Rupert N. Richardson discussing an unnamed bill concerning the State Archives. Latimer writes that the bill cannot be considered until the General Appropriations bill has passed but that he believes the archives, along with teachers, and other groups, will be adequately taken care of.

[Letter from Truett Latimer to Dr. Rupert N. Richardson, January 17, 1957]

Letter from Truett Latimer to W. Rupert N. Richardson discussing Governor Daniel's address to the legislature, in which he asked for funding for a State Archives Building. Latimer writes that he does not know how the legislature will act but that he will keep Richardson updated on the bill's status.
